  • Not a doctor, but if fever free for 24 hours, no real point to take him to the doctor. They are going to listen to his lungs, check for ear infection, and then say "it sounds like he had a little virus that ran its course."

    Usually if they had a fever and now don't, they are on the road to recovery. Also, the doctor probably won't give him medicine to ward off being sick for Christmas--it doesn't sound like something bacterial (because no prolonged fever). Our little guy got a 24 hour bug this weekend, and we just did lots of water/milk/snuggles/ibuprofen to sleep and waited for the fever to go away. Today, he is still calmer than usual--but I know he is on the mend because he woke up without a fever.
